In the formation of an adhesive bond, a transitional zone arises in the interface between adherend and adhesive. In this zone, known as the interphase, the chemical and physical properties of the adhesive may be considerably completely different from those within the noncontact parts. It is usually believed that the interphase composition controls the durability and strength of an adhesive joint and is primarily responsible for the transference of stress from one adherend to a different. The interphase region is incessantly the site of environmental attack, resulting in joint failure. Often, a portion of the reaction between the isocyanate and polyol is done to form the adhesive; this is referred to as a prepolymer. This NCO-terminated prepolymer is then cured with a polyol to type the cured adhesive. Alternatively, the adhesive element could also be OH terminated chemicals and adhesives subsequently cured with an isocyanate to form the cured polyurethane adhesive.

The chemistry of resin-based dental adhesives is critical for its interplay with dental tissues and long-term bonding stability. Maintaining an acceptable reactivity between photoinitiators and monomers is necessary for optimal properties of adhesive systems, in order to allow adequate polymerisation and improved chemical, bodily and organic properties.
